This document provides an outline for a unit on sensitivity that includes:
1) The functions of sensitivity and the five main senses - sight, hearing, touch, taste, and smell.
2) An overview of the sense organs associated with each sense and how they receive and respond to stimuli from the external environment.
3) A description of the nervous system, including the central nervous system made up of the brain and spinal cord, and the peripheral nervous system consisting of sensory and motor nerves.
